Formulation Guidelines for Synovea HR Synovea HR Hexylresorcinol is a well-defined material with a guaranteed purity of 99%. Generally speaking, Synovea HR is one of the very few phenolic skin lightening agents, which will be white and remain white in appearance in formulated products. At 45 0 C for two months & > 2 years at RT, lotions containing 1.0% and 0.5% Synovea HR showed minimal color shift. We have developed a series of application guideline tips that will assist the formulator to make products that are as aesthetically pleasing and stable as possible. Synovea HR is highly soluble in Caprylic/Capric Triglycerides, Isosorbide Dicapylate, Ethyl Linoleate, Ethoxydiglycol, and other high polarity esters, non-ionic solubilizers, glycerol and a wide-range of glycols. Synovea HR should be used at a level of 0.5 1.0% (w/w) of finished formulation. Dissolve 0.5 g of Synovea HR in about 2 g of ethoxydiglycol, glycerol, butylene glycol or propylene glycol and add to the formulation after making emulsion, preferably below 50 C. Non-ionic emulsifiers are preferable over anionic types. For preparation of serum or transparent gel, use non-ionic solubilizers having high HLB values like PEG- 40 hydrogenated castor oil, Laureth 23, Polysorbate 20 & Polysorbate 80. Synovea HR is a phenolic compound. Therefore, presence of Iron or Copper ions must be avoided to reduce coloration due to interaction with these metal ions. Addition of a small amount of disodium EDTA (0.1%) or other suitable chelating agents resolves this problem. The finished product must be acidic, preferably having ph below 6.0. A ph below 5.5 is recommended when potassium sorbate or sodium benzoate are used as preservatives. Formulations containing Synovea HR may cause drop in viscosity. Anionic (such as, Xanthan gum, Carbomers) or neutral thickeners (such as, Cellulosics) are good for maintaining desired viscosity. The finished product should be protected from prolong exposure to heat and light. Airless/opaque packaging is highly recommended for protecting product integrity and stability over time. July 2013 1
